Jul 01, 2023 The Card Player Poker Tour is once again teaming up with [bestbet Jacksonville,]( home of the largest poker room in Florida, for a nine-event tournament series. The [2023 CPPT bestbet Jacksonville]( is scheduled for Aug. 10-21. This will be the tenth CPPT festival held at the North Florida poker hotspot. While past CPPT bestbet festivals have been built around a standard no-limit hold’em tournament, this year the centerpiece of the series will be the $1,700 buy-in $300,000 guaranteed Mystery Bounty main event. The tournament will run from Thursday, Aug. 17 through Monday, Aug. 21, with a massive top bounty prize of $50,000. The Mystery Bounty main event sports three starting flights, each beginning at noon on Aug. 17-19. Players will start with 30,0000 in chips as they battle to make it to day 2, which will be livestreamed on bestbetLIVE, the card room’s popular [YouTube,]( [Twitch,]( and [Facebook Live]( channel that hosts tournament and cash game action. The stream will document all the excitement as players secure and open their mystery bounties. The main event final table will be also streamed on bestbetLIVE on Aug. 21, as will the final day of the $100,000 guaranteed $400 buy-in kickoff event (streamed Aug. 13) and the final table of the $300 ladies event (streamed Aug. 16). Flesch reading score

Flesch reading score measures how complex a text is. The lower the score, the more difficult the text is to read. The Flesch readability score uses the average length of your sentences (measured by the number of words) and the average number of syllables per word in an equation to calculate the reading ease. Text with a very high Flesch reading ease score (about 100) is straightforward and easy to read, with short sentences and no words of more than two syllables. Usually, a reading ease score of 60-70 is considered acceptable/normal for web copy.
